Where to Buy Pokémon TCG Single Cards

### TCG Player

3See it at TCG Player

TCGPlayer remains one of the top platforms for buying specific single cards. Instead of gambling on booster packs, you can directly purchase the cards you want. It’s also useful for checking accurate market values rather than guessing based on random Amazon listings.

There are still solid deals to be found—you just need to invest time into searching. Think of it as Pokémon eBay, but with a cleaner interface and better verification tools.

Pokémon TCG Expansions: Release Schedule

Scarlet & Violet: Destined Rivals (May 30)

The next major release in the Pokémon TCG lineup, Destined Rivals, arrives on May 30, and anticipation is already building. This set reintroduces Team Rocket, brings back classic Trainer Pokémon cards, and features some of the most stunning artwork seen in recent years.

Whether you're collecting for nostalgia or gameplay, this set promises something for everyone.

Scarlet & Violet: Black Bolt and White Flare (July 18)

The upcoming dual expansion, Black Bolt and White Flare, continues the Scarlet & Violet series and is scheduled for release on July 18, 2025. Each set focuses on different Unova-region Pokémon, offering unique illustration rare cards exclusive to each version.

Preorders have begun appearing online, so make sure to monitor these listings closely.
